Reading reviews well
What to look for in a container review
A five star rating tells you very little. These are the details that actually help.
Did the specification match?
The single most useful thing a reviewer can confirm is that the unit which arrived matched the dimensions and configuration on the product page.
How did delivery go?
Placement is where container purchases most often go wrong. A review that describes the access, the truck and the final positioning is worth ten that say “fast delivery”.
What condition were the doors in?
Doors are the moving part. A reviewer noting that the cam bars turned freely and the seals were intact is telling you the unit was properly prepared.
How long did it actually take?
Estimated transit is 5 business days on standard delivery. Reviews that state the real figure help set expectations.
What happened when there was a problem?
No supplier gets everything right. How a company behaves when something goes wrong is more informative than a perfect run.
Was the condition grade accurate?
Used and refurbished units carry cosmetic wear by definition. A good review says whether the wear matched what was described.
